Phase 1 construction in the works for new charter school

SEAFORD, Del.- After two years of fine tuning the details, the Sussex Montessori School announced that work is beginning on Phase 1 of construction of a new public charter school.

With the expectation already of 250 students to attend, the free public Montessori School has started their final testing work.

The school saw the historic structure that was an old farm complex as the ideal place to have the school.

The property had to be first annexed into the city, but now that Phase 1 of construction will be starting, leaders working on the construction told us that they are excited to break ground on this prime location.

“We think this is ideal the setting for this location, it’s just wonderful, that was the goal was to try and find something that had kind of an agriculture environmental background to it and feel to it and we think this is just wonderful,” Mark Chura, Chief Operating Officer, said. “It’s a historic structure as wel,l this is an old farm complex it fits really well with the Montessori method.”

Officials told us that there will be a ground breaking ceremony soon in February for the Phase 1 of their construction project.

They will be set to finish the construction before the school opens sometime after Labor Day in 2020.
